Scene from the first college hoops game I've attended this year. South Dakota State travels to Dunk City to take on Florida Gulf Coast. FGCU beats the Jackbunnies 84-78 after one particular ref had it in his head that he was going to foul out SDSU's best player, Mike Daum (look him up, he's a good one), with a pair of questionable offensive foul calls. Rabbits led by 13 late in the first half, FGCU shot their way back in the game but SDSU had their 3 best players foul out and made two inexplicable turnovers against a press that led to layups.

While y'all were sleeping, Texas Southern went on the road and took out the Quacks by erasing a 13-point 2nd half deficit by raining 3's. This is the second big road win they've had this year after beating Baylor in the first week of the season. Last year, Texas Southern played something like 12 straight road games to start the year in order to fund the athletic department. That competition led to them winning their conference championship. This might be a team to keep an eye on again when we get to March and you discount them as getting 20-23 points as a 15 seed.
